Output 2661429a4e48842dc773a29a0b55d9960e962713c145b45f18f7eef606531646:6

value
188396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ae622cf046e17d79b41a992f208d63d6082bf857 OP_EQUAL
address
3Hb57H6weLK3vpuEW9nxsYdHPkB51ELyNm
transaction
2661429a4e48842dc773a29a0b55d9960e962713c145b45f18f7eef606531646
spent
true